The M5 World Championship brings together the top players from around the world in the game Mobile Legends: Bang Bang (MLBB). While AP. Bren emerged as the winner and claimed the title of the best in the world, there were other players who also stood out and captured the attention of the audience.

These players demonstrated exceptional skills and talent that exceeded expectations, making a significant impact on their respective teams. Their unique playstyles set them apart and make them players to watch in the upcoming season of Mobile Legends.

So, who are these players? Let’s take a closer look at the three players who stole the spotlight in The M5 World Championship.

Honorable Mention:

In addition to the three best players who will be mentioned later, there are two names that come to mind. Ahmet “Rosa” Batir from FireFlux Esports and Kiel “OHEB” Q.Soriano from Blacklist International have both impressed with their performances in different stages of the competition.

Rosa, the midlaner from FF Esports, amazed everyone with his dominance in the group stage. Initially expected to be an easy target for other teams, FireFlux surprised everyone by finishing in the top spot in their group, which included SMG, RRQ Akira, and Blacklist International.

Rosa even received the MVP award twice during the group stage.

On the other hand, OHEB from Blacklist International has truly shined in the knockout phase of the M5 World Championship. He is undoubtedly the best player on his team and has become known for his ability to perform under pressure.

When his team needs him the most, he always manages to step up and deliver outstanding performances.

3. KidBomba – Deus Vult

When we think of the M5 World Championship, one name stands out – KidBomba from Deus Vult. What sets him apart is not only his performance on the arena, but also his demeanor on and off the stage. He exudes confidence in his gameplay, and his charisma shines through when he speaks.

One of KidBomba’s most endearing qualities is his passion for the game. A notable moment was when Deus Vult made a remarkable 10K net-worth comeback against Geek Fam ID,

with KidBomba leading the charge as Terizla, serving as an immovable pillar in their defense. We will be closely watching his progress and can expect to see him in future M World Championship events.

2. CW – ONIC Esports

First of all, let’s address the elephant in the room – no one should be held responsible for ONIC’s loss in the grand final. Every player performed remarkably well; however, sometimes luck does not favor even the strongest.

Throughout the tournament, in my opinion, one player who consistently stood out for ONIC Esports is CW.

This is not to undermine the contributions of the other team members, but CW truly embodies perseverance and stability. His ability to adapt and use various heroes in the Gold Lane creates difficulty for the opposing team in predicting his strategies.

A perfect illustration of his versatility was seen in the series against AP. Bren in the Upper Bracket Final.

1. FlapTzy – The MVP of AP.Bren in M5 World Championship

Undoubtedly, the standout player of AP.Bren and the M5 World Championship is David “FlapTzy” Canon. Hailing from The Philippines, this 19-year-old player is the true definition of a game-changer.

He played a crucial role in securing the victory for Bren Esports, reclaiming their title in the M2 World Championship.

FlapTzy’s controlled explosiveness on the battlefield makes him one of the most formidable players in the M5 World Championship. He dominates the game and, at the same time, supports his teammates with a composed and calm demeanor.

His performance in the Grand Final against ONIC Esports perfectly showcased these exceptional qualities.
